Trump Border Czar Tom Homan Faces Protests Over Immigration Policies at NY Capitol
Homan criticized New York's sanctuary policies and vowed to escalate ICE enforcement during a tense visit to Albany.
- Tom Homan, President Trump's border czar, visited the New York State Capitol to advocate for stricter immigration enforcement and cooperation with ICE.
- Homan criticized New York's sanctuary policies, including the Green Light Law, which allows undocumented immigrants to obtain driver's licenses.
- During his visit, Homan faced intense protests from activists and Democratic lawmakers, with chants and confrontations over federal immigration policies.
- Homan warned that non-cooperation with ICE would lead to increased federal enforcement, stating, 'Sanctuary cities will get exactly what they don’t want: more ICE agents in their communities.'
- New York State Assembly Member Zohran Mamdani confronted Homan over the detention of Columbia University student Mahmoud Khalil, a case that has drawn significant public attention.
